
J&K’s only AAP MLA Mehraj Malik booked for threatening, abusing woman doctor
In a shocking incident, Jammu and Kashmir’s only Aam Aadmi Party (AAP) MLA, Mehraj Malik, has been booked by the police for allegedly threatening and abusing a woman doctor. The doctor, who works at a government medical college in Doda, had accused Malik of making “abusive, gendered and derogatory remarks” against her online.
According to a report by The Indian Express, the woman doctor had filed a complaint with the police, alleging that Malik had threatened to drag her and strip her naked. The incident has sparked widespread outrage and condemnation, with many calling for Malik’s immediate resignation.

The police have registered a case against Malik under sections 354 D (stalking), 506 (criminal intimidation), 509 (word, gesture or act intended to insult the modesty of a woman) and 34 (common intention) of the Indian Penal Code. An investigation is underway, and Malik has been asked to appear before the police for questioning.
